n is an integer, so 2n+1 is also an integer. 8s+1 is equal to the square of 2n+1, so it's a square number.
2n+1 is an odd integer for any value of n. The square of an odd integer is always an odd integer. Therefore 8s+1=(2n+1)² is odd.
8s+1 is an odd square number.

(x + 15)(x + 5) = 96
x^2 + 20x + 75 = 96
(x + 10)^2 - 100 + 75 = 96
(x + 10)^2 = 96 +25 = 121
taking square roots:-
x + 10 = 11
x = 1

There is no sign in between 2b and 6.
Case 1:
Assuming the sign is '+'
Then, 2b + 6 for b = 9 is given by 2(9) + 6 = 18 + 6 = 24.
Case 2:
Assuming the sign is '-'
Then, 2b - 6 for b = 9 is given by 2(9) - 6 = 18 - 6 = 12.
Case 3:
Assuming the sign is 'x'
Then, 2b x 6 for b = 9 is given by 2(9) x 6 = 18 x 6 = 108.
Case 4:
Assuming the sign is '÷'
Then, 2b ÷ 6 for b = 9 is given by 2(9) ÷ 6 = 18 ÷ 6 = 3.
